Introduction Ink-Lique’™ Lecture 1.5 hours

Ink-Lique’™ is the unique process Sherry used on her quilt Tribal Fusion, Lollapalooza and Hallelujah that have taken numerous ribbons and accolades over the past several years. In this presentation you will learn Sherry’s design process and all of Sherry’s secrets to inking and painting success.  Sherry will go over each step of her technique with you from the beginning in 2007 to its progression into 2013 and bring oodles of inspiration to lead you down her colorful path.

Sherry will provide a PowerPoint presentation and a trunk show of all of her colorful quilts

Paint-Lique™

Every adult likes to color, why not on a fabric? Have you ever quilted a whole cloth quilt and had it disappear on your wall? Do you wish your digitized designs were more colorful?  In this class we will dip into the colorful world of dry pigment paints and make that plain whole cloth quilt sing!  Sherry will provide a pre-quilted sample and provide you with all her painting experience so that you can customize the quilt with your favorite color combinations. We will be using Primary Elements - Polished Pigments Pure Color™  www.dreamingcolor.com. Sherry will provide many pigments for classroom use and has oodles of samples to drool over. You'll never look at another quilt design or embroidery design the same boring way again! Everyone is welcome and no quilting experience is necessary to enjoy this exciting technique!

 Kit Fee include a pre-quilted original design by Sherry, 4 pigments and a 3 oz bottle of PaintFusion.

Color it Done!

Adding color to a quilted piece is taking the quilting world by storm and Sherry is providing an awesome workshop to share the colorful techniques she has been developing over the past several years! Sherry is providing each student with a pre-quilted original design so that you can start coloring that quilt done right away! You will be using Sherry’s vast collection of ink pencils, Gelly Roll pens and Polished Pigments and you will learn how to choose colors, which technique best fits your quilt, shading, highlighting and antiquing and the importance of outlining.  No quilting experience is necessary to enjoy the benefit of this class.

kit fee includes a pre-quilted mini quilt, 1 Inktense colored pencil for antiquing, 4 pots of Polished Pigments and a 3 oz bottle of PaintFusion.
